About This Home
Welcome to Park Avenue Estates! This stunning custom home blends timeless traditional design with luxurious modern finishes. Located on a prestigious corner lot in North Dover,it offers over 6,600 sq ft of refined living space with 7 bedrooms,6.5 bathrooms,and a full basement. A grand horseshoe driveway leads to a 3-car garage with sleek Wi-Fi-enabled doors. Inside,a dramatic 2-story foyer with a double staircase sets the tone. The main level includes elegant living and dining spaces,a gourmet marble kitchen with Wolf and Subzero appliances,a sunken great room with coffered ceilings,and a private in-law suite. Upstairs,the lavish primary suite features two walk-in closets,a sitting room,and a spa-like bathroom. Five additional bedrooms and a laundry room complete the second floor. The 3,200 sq ft unfinished basement offers plenty of rooms for storage,and the large fully fenced backyard is ready to be enjoyed. Thoughtfully designed by HH Designers and built by Prima Builders,this home includes high-end finishes,smart features,and energy-efficient systems throughout. Experience elevated living at its finest

Most of Toms River is on the New Jersey mainland, but a section of the city on Barnegat Peninsula enjoys a beautiful beachfront position on the Atlantic Ocean, adjacent to Seaside Heights. Because of this split, the community has a distinct variance in atmosphere depending on where in town you are: the areas along the ocean and Barnegat Bay frequently see droves of tourists in the summer months, and the locals in the coastal parts of town enjoy a classic seaside lifestyle often involving boating, fishing, and soaking in the sunshine.
While folks farther inland enjoy convenient access to the beach as well, most of the mainland portion of the city enjoys a more traditional atmosphere, with quiet residential neighborhoods and a charming downtown district on the banks of the eponymous river. Residents also have the benefit of living just ninety minutes from both New York City and Philadelphia, putting two of America’s biggest and most exciting cities within easy weekend trip distance.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
